Rahul Gandhi Slammed Modi Govt For GST Rollout On Twitter, Calling It A Self-Promotional ‘Tamasha’

The Modi government has rolled out Goods and Service Tax (GST) from July 1 despite stiff resistance from the opposition which is still slamming the government for implementing GST in a hasty manner. Congress and some other opposition parties boycotted the mega event of GST launch which took place on Friday midnight. The event was conducted at Central Hall of Parliament and President Pranab Mukherjee and PM Modi both rolled out GST together.

Rahul Gandhi Slammed Modi Govt For GST Rollout On Twitter, Calling It A Self-Promotional ‘Tamasha’ - RVCJ Media

Source

Congress is lending support to GST but it has a problem with the manner in which it is being implemented. Rahul Gandhi, Congress VP, is presently on holidays but he took to Twitter to express his and his party’s disagreement on the matter in a series of tweets. As per him, the implementation of GST is a “tamasha” and the manner in which it is being implemented in “half-baked”. He adds that it is a “self-promotional spectacle” of the Modi government. He has alleged that the government is implementing GST without any preparation and backup just as it did at the time of demonetisation.
